Under a dilation with center at the origin and scale factor k, a point (x,y) maps to which coordinates?

Explanation:
When you dilate with the center at the origin, you scale every distance from the origin by the factor k, keeping the direction from the origin the same. That means the position vector (x, y) becomes k times every component, giving (kx, ky). For example, if k = 2, (3, 4) goes to (6, 8); if k = 1/2, it goes to (1.5, 2). Negative k would flip the point to the opposite ray and scale its distance.
